- 0
- 0
- 约5.59千字
- 约 11页
- 2026-02-10 发布于上海
- 举报
云计算Serverless架构的优势
引言
在云计算技术快速演进的今天,Serverless(无服务器)架构作为一种革命性的计算模型,正逐渐成为企业数字化转型的核心选择。与传统的服务器托管、容器化部署等模式不同,Serverless将“服务器”这一技术实体从开发者的日常工作中剥离,通过云服务商提供的底层能力,让开发者只需聚焦业务逻辑本身。这种模式不仅改变了技术团队的工作方式,更从成本、效率、弹性等多个维度重构了云计算的应用场景。本文将围绕Serverless架构的核心优势展开,通过技术、经济、运维、效率等多维度的深入分析,揭示其为何能成为云计算领域的重要发展方向。
一、技术门槛的显著降低:从“管机器”到“写代码”的转变
传统云计算模式下,开发者的工作往往被服务器管理占据大量精力。无论是选择服务器配置、部署运行环境,还是处理网络安全、容灾备份等问题,都需要深厚的技术积累和持续的运维投入。而Serverless架构的出现,彻底改变了这一局面。
(一)无需关注底层服务器管理
在传统架构中,一个简单的API接口开发可能需要经历服务器采购(或云服务器租用)、操作系统安装、运行环境配置(如Java的JDK、Python的虚拟环境)、网络端口开放、安全组设置等一系列操作。这些步骤不仅耗时,还要求开发者熟悉服务器硬件、操作系统、网络协议等多领域知识。例如,某创业团队开发一款在线文档协作工具时,初期因技术人员对服务器负载均衡配置不熟悉,导致系统在用户量激增时频繁崩溃,不得不花费数周时间调整架构。
而在Serverless架构下,开发者只需编写实现具体功能的代码(如处理用户登录的函数、生成文档的逻辑),并将代码上传至云服务商提供的函数计算平台(如AWSLambda、阿里云函数计算等)。底层的服务器分配、资源调度、运行环境维护等工作完全由云服务商自动完成。开发者无需了解服务器的具体型号、操作系统版本,甚至不需要知道代码运行在哪个数据中心的哪台机器上。这种“开箱即用”的特性,让刚入门的开发者也能快速上手复杂功能的开发,极大降低了技术团队的入门门槛。
(二)自动扩缩容简化架构设计
传统分布式系统中,为了应对流量波动(如电商大促、直播活动),技术团队需要提前预测峰值流量,手动调整服务器数量,设计复杂的负载均衡策略和容错机制。例如,某视频平台在热门剧集上线前,需要组织专项团队进行压力测试,根据测试结果增加50%的服务器实例,并配置自动扩缩容规则,但仍可能因预测偏差导致部分用户访问卡顿或资源浪费。
Serverless架构的“事件驱动”特性彻底解决了这一问题。当用户请求(如点击网页按钮、上传文件)触发某个函数时,云服务商会根据请求量自动创建或销毁函数实例。例如,一个处理图片上传的Serverless函数,在日常情况下可能只有1-2个实例运行;当突发大量用户上传图片时,系统会在几秒内启动数十甚至数百个实例,确保请求及时处理;当流量回落时,多余的实例又会自动释放。这种“无限弹性”的能力,让开发者无需再为架构的扩展性绞尽脑汁,只需专注于函数本身的业务逻辑是否正确。
二、成本结构的优化:从“按资源付费”到“按使用付费”的革新
成本控制是企业IT建设的核心诉求之一。传统云计算模式下,服务器、存储、网络等资源通常采用“预付费”或“包年包月”的购买方式,企业需要为闲置资源支付费用。而Serverless架构通过“按需付费”的模式,将成本与实际使用量直接绑定,显著提升了资源利用率。
(一)精准计费模式减少闲置成本
传统云服务器的计费方式多为“时间+配置”,例如租用一台4核8G的服务器,无论其CPU利用率是5%还是100%,企业都需要按小时或按月支付固定费用。这种模式下,企业为了应对业务峰值,往往需要提前采购超过日常需求的服务器资源,导致大量资源在非峰值时段处于闲置状态。据统计,传统企业的服务器平均利用率普遍低于30%,这意味着70%的成本支付给了未被使用的资源。
Serverless架构采用“按调用次数+执行时间”的计费方式。以函数计算为例,云服务商通常按函数被触发的次数(每百万次调用为一个计费单位)和函数实际运行的时长(精确到毫秒)收费。例如,一个处理用户评论的函数,若一天内仅被调用100次,每次运行50毫秒,企业只需支付几厘钱的费用;若遇到用户集中评论(如某热点事件引发讨论),函数被调用10万次,每次运行100毫秒,费用也仅相当于几杯咖啡的成本。这种“用多少付多少”的模式,彻底消除了资源闲置带来的成本浪费,尤其适合流量波动大、使用频率不固定的业务场景(如活动营销系统、物联网设备数据处理)。
(二)资源整合降低综合运营成本
除了直接的资源费用,传统架构还隐含着大量隐性成本。例如,为了保障服务器的稳定运行,企业需要组建专门的运维团队,负责服务器监控、补丁更新、故障排查等工
您可能关注的文档
- 2026年保荐代表人资格考试考试题库(附答案和详细解析)(0112).docx
- 2026年普通话水平测试考试题库(附答案和详细解析)(0130).docx
- 2026年残障服务协调员考试题库(附答案和详细解析)(0115).docx
- 2026年法律职业资格考试(法考)考试题库(附答案和详细解析)(0127).docx
- 2026年游戏设计师资格认证考试题库(附答案和详细解析)(0120).docx
- CFA一级伦理道德科目“七准则”考点解析.docx
- O2O模式在本地生活服务中的应用与优化.docx
- 《聊斋志异》中狐鬼形象的人性光辉.docx
- 中国乒协2026新年寄语.docx
- 云计算IaaS服务协议.docx
- 广西南宁2025-2026秋季期末八年级【语文】试卷(含答案).pdf
- 广西南宁2025-2026秋季期末高一化学试卷(含答案).pdf
- 广西南宁2025-2026秋季期末九年级数学试卷(含答案).pdf
- 广西南宁2025-2026秋季期末高一英语(含答案,无听力音频).pdf
- 广西南宁2025-2026秋季期末高一地理试卷(含答案).pdf
- 内科护理(中职):心包疾病病人的护理PPT教学课件.ppt
- 胆管结石的中医护理方法.ppt
- 内科护理(中职):心肌疾病病人的护理PPT教学课件.ppt
- 内科护理(中职):心律失常病人的护理PPT教学课件.ppt
- 嵌入式系统实践及工程应用—从基础到人工智能:具备AI算力的嵌入式系统开发PPT教学课件.pptx
原创力文档

文档评论(0)